Dr.Sreenath specializes in Complex spinal deformity correction, Revision spinal surgery, Minimally invasive surgery, Anterior and Oblique lumbar fusions, Dynamic fixations, Day care fusions.

Post completion of MBBS from NTRUHS, Dr.Sreenath pursued and completed his M.S in Orthopedic surgery from NTRUHS. With a passion for excelling in spine surgery, he has completed many prestigious fellowships from reputed institutes world wide. He has a fellowship in spine surgery followed by Fellowship in spinal deformity and spinal tumours from Hamamatsu University school of medicine, Japan which is one of the biggest spine centers through out the globe. Dr.Sreenath also has a Fellowship in complex spinal deformity in Centre Hospitalier Universitaire(CHU) de Bordeaux, France where he had the exposure to numerous spinal deformities with varied types.

AWARDS & HONOURS

Excellence in spine care, Dr. Sreenath Rao Jakinapally has earned recognition for innovation, surgical precision, patient outcomes, and dedication worldwide.

Won best paper award in complex deformity category in Institute colonne vertebrale spine meet in 2019 entitled - Preoperative Halo Skeletal Traction for Severe Scoliosis.

Won best paper award in Japanese scoliosis meet in 2019 entitled - Differences in the geometrical spinal shape in the sagittal planeaccording to age and magnitude of pelvic incidence in healthy elderly individuals.

Won best paper award in SOLAS 2019 entitled - A Novel Technique For Reduction Of Spondyloptosis With Minimal Access Surgery (MIS TLIF): Technical Report

Won best poster award in Tosacon 2018 entitled - Anterior debulking of an aggressive osteoblastoma of cervical spine leading to vertebral artery injury - a case report.

IGASS Research Grant: for adult spinal deformity surgical decision-making score.
